Alive & Kicking set-up and run football making factories in Africa providing employment and as a knock-on effect providing for families and the communities of the workers. They also advocate for child’s rights and HIV awareness using the footballs as mechanisms to spread education.

 

Guests at the annual ALMT Burns Night gala dinner pledged their support to fund a rolling machine for the Ghana stitching centre. This allowed Alive and Kicking to roll their own leather, adding canvas backing that is required to add strength to the leather and make it suitable for football production and, importantly, make the balls last longer!
